赞
踩
合并分支的两种方式:
前提: 有两个分支
master
testing
一般在testing上开发,然后将代码编译打包合并到master上, 现在有两种方式:
第一种(很麻烦~):
0: testing分支上:
1: vim 1.txt
2: git add 1.txt
3: git commit -m "new 1.txt"
4: git push origin testing / (git push)
-------切换分支,太麻烦了
5: git checkout master
6: git merge testing (现在在master上, 将testing的代码合并到master上-本地的仓库)
7: git push orign master (git push 推到master远程库)
8: git checkout testing
第二种方式(不用切换分支~~)
0: testing分支上:
1: vim 2.txt
2: git add 2.txt
3: git commit -m "new 2.txt"
4: git push origin testing / (git push)
--- 不用切换分支了呀(下面这行命令你们自己去理解去查手册)
5: git fetch origin testing:master
6: git push origin master (这里必须指定 origin 是 master)
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。